1200 V, 15 A fast recovery diode in DO-247

The STTH15S12W is a 1200 V, 15 A fast recovery diode from STMicroelectronics in a DO-247 through-hole package. Its 40 ns reverse recovery time qualifies it for high-frequency switching in PFC boost stages, output rectification, and snubber circuits where recovery losses drive thermal design.

40 ns trr — switching loss in the high-voltage rail

The 40 ns reverse recovery time is the headline switching spec. Forward voltage is 3.1 V at 15 A.

STMicroelectronics lists the STTH15S12W as obsolete.
